#127b70 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#127b70 is composed of 7.1% red, 48.2%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.9% yellow and 51.8% black. It has a hue angle of 173.7 degrees, a saturation of 74.5% and a lightness of 27.6%. #127b70 color hex could be obtained by blending #24f6e0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

Shades and Tints of #127b70

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000303 is the darkest color, while #f1fd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#127b70

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#434a49 is the less saturated color, while #028b7d is the most saturated one.
